Description
The vulnerability allows a local user to gain unauthorized access to otherwise restricted functionality.
The vulnerability exists due to improper access restrictions in the installer. A local user can bypass implemented security restrictions and cause a denial of service (DoS) condition on the target system.
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versions
Intel Chipset Device Software INF Utility: before 10.1.18
